Originally Posted by dchar
Anyone else notice the abysmal average mpg on the cluster display in the video of the GS200t? I thought fuel economy was suppose to be improved in a smaller engine


Putting a turbo charged 4 cyl in a larger heavier car almost never really works out. The 4 cyl turbo in the Mustang gets worse fuel economy then the 6 cylinder, the 4 cyl turbo in the Acura RDX got worse fuel economy then the higher hp quicker V6, there are other models where the 4 cylinders get worse fuel economy then the 6 cylinders they replace.

This is a sad trend sticking 4 cylinders in larger heavier cars they are not suited for for no real benefit in the real world.
